dc.description.abstract This study was conducted to determine the percentage of uterine bacterial infection among PP cross-breddairy cows and to evaluate its influence on their reproductive efficiency. Furthermore, the effects of intra-uterine infusion of iodine compounds (1% Lugol's iodine and 2% Povidone iodine) on the reproductive efficiency of PP and repeat breeder dairy cows was investigated. Experiment I. was designed to determine the incidence of uterine bacterial infection among early PP dairy cows. Furthermore, the effects of uterine bacterial infection on PP reproductive efficiency of the same cows were evaluated by studying six reproductive parameters. These parameters were uterine involution, appearance of the first DF, appearance of the FO, length of DO, rate of service per conception and CI. Uterine endometrium swabs were collected on day 5 PP from 130 dairy cows and werecultured within 2 hours of collection in blood agar media and MacConkey agar media. The uteri of 120 cows (93%) were found infected and 10 cows (7%) were found none infected. From the total infected cows 40 cows were used to evaluate the effect of bacterial uterine infection on their reproductive performance. Twenty cows were severely infected and the remaining cows (20 cows) were mildly infected. The result of this experiment showed that dairy cows that suffered sever uterine bacterial infection had a significantly (P<0.001) extended uterine involution period, long time for the appearance of the DF and the FO, the length of DO and CI compared to the dairy cows that suffered mild uterine bacterial infection. Moreover, the dairy cows which suffered sever uterine bacterial infection had a significantly (P<0.001) increased rate of 13 service per conception compared tothe cows with mild uterine bacterial infection. Experiment II. This experiment was conducted to study the effects of intra-uterine infusion of diluted Lugol's iodine on PP reproductive efficiency of cows having uterine bacterial infection. From the remaining cows that were diagnosed as severely infected in experimentI, 40 cows having severe uterine bacterial infection were selected. The cows divided randomlyinto two equal groups (A) and (B) 20 cow each. Group A was intra-uterine infused with 1% Lugol’s iodine on day 5 PP. Group B was left untreated to serve as a control. The above mentioned parameters were evaluated. The result of this experiment showed that infusion of 1% Lugol’s iodine significantly improved (P<0.0001) all the reproductive parameters compared to the control. Experiment III. This experiment was conducted to study the effects of intra-uterine infusion of diluted Povidone iodine on PP reproductive efficiency of cows having uterine bacterial infection. From the remaining cows that were diagnosed as severely infected in experimentI, 40 cows having severe uterine bacterial infection were selected. The cows were divided randomly into two equal groups (A) and (B) 20 cow each. Group A was intra-uterine infused with Povidone iodine on day 5 PP. Group B was left untreated to serve as control. The above mentioned parameters were evaluated. The result of this experiment showed thatinfusion of 2% Povidone iodine significantly improved (P<0.0001) all the reproductive parameters compared to the control. Experiment IV. was conducted to study the possibility of using diluted Lugol’s iodine for treating repeat breeder cow syndrome. Sixty cross-bred repeat breeder dairy cowswere used in this experiment. 14 Uterine swabs were collected from uteri of all cows. After bacterial culture all the selected cows werefound mildly infected. They were then grouped randomly into three groups. Group A (n = 20 cows) was intra-uterine infused with 1% Lugol’s iodine 6 hours pre-insemination. Group B (n = 20 cows) was infused with the same solution 6 hours post-insemination. Group C (n = 20 cows) was left without treatment to serve as control. The potency ofdiluted Lugol’s iodine to cure repeat breeder cow syndrome was evaluated by studying the DO, rate of service per conception and the CI. The results of this experiment showed that, the DO, rate of service per conception and CI were significantly (P<0.001) reduced by infusion of diluted Lugol's solution 6 hours pre/post insemination as compared to the control. Experiment V. was conducted to study the possibility of using diluted Povidone iodine for treating repeat breeder cow syndrome. Sixty cross-bred repeat breeder dairy cows were used in this experiment. Uterine swabs were collected from uteri of all cows. After bacterial culture all the selected cows were found mildly infected. They were then grouped randomly into three groups. Group A (n = 20 cows) was intra-uterine infused with 2% Povidone iodine 6 hours preinsemination. Group B (n = 20 cows) was infused with the same solution 6 hours post-insemination. Group C (n = 20 cows) was left untreated to serve as control. The potency of diluted Povidone iodine to cure repeat breeder cow syndrome was evaluated by studying the same parameters as in experiment 4. The findings of this experiment showed that, the infusion of diluted Povidone iodine pre/post insemination significantly (P<0.001) reduced the DO and CI as compared to the control. Furthermore, the rate of service per conception was significantly (P<0.001)minimized compared to the control. 15 It is concluded that, the reduced reproductive efficiency of cross-bred dairy cows is likely to be due to early PP uterine bacterial mild infection that decreases reproductive efficiency and leads to repeat breeding syndrome later. Intra-uterine infusion of 1% Lugol's iodine can be used successfully to improve the PP reproductive performance of cross-bred dairy cows. en_US
